NEW DELHI: Twenty affiliated teams will participate in the Delhi Soccer Association (DSA) annual ‘B’ Division open clubs football league championship from October 3 at the Ambedkar Stadium and Air Force grounds. The grouping of the participating teams was decided at the club secretaries meeting held on Wednesday. The top two teams from each group will qualify for the super league which will be played on a round-robin basis. The top two finishers in the super league will be promoted to ‘A’ division next year. The groupings of the ‘A’ division league will be decided in the second week of October only after Delhi Police and Raisina Sporting Union Club confirm their participation.
